What is TrustLink?
|
|
TrustLink is a program that assists businesses and consumers in building trusted relationships in an online community. TrustLink publishes hundreds of thousands of business storefronts containing valuable feedback from customers along with other important information on the businesses. The service is free to the public.

What's a 'TrustLink Verified' review?
|
- When a review is labeled 'TrustLink Verified Review', it means that the customer who wrote the review was engaged in some type of business transaction with the company. This label is added to the review only if we can verify that the experience in the review took place. Potential customers reading a 'TrustLink Verified' review can use the information to help them decide which reviews are helpful in their decision to do business with the company.If a review is not marked as 'TrustLink Verified Review', it doesn't mean that the customer didn't have that experience with the company. It simply means that we weren't able to verify that the transaction took place because the customer did not go through one of our channels of communication with the company.

How do consumers file a complaint?
|
- TrustLink doesn’t handle individual customer complaints. However, if a negative review is posted, often a business will make an effort to rectify the problem so that the writer will modify the review and the rating. Most businesses recognize the importance of maintaining a good rating with TrustLink.

Are customer reviews monitored?
|
- Yes. Reviews are monitored by experienced staff to ensure that they comply with our policies. We evaluate postings for authenticity and will remove reviews we believe have been deliberately planted. We also remove reviews containing abusive or inappropriate language. Personal reviews reflect one person's experience with a business but they lack industry context or other historical data.
